Please take care of the eyes. To get rid of the mucus, use cotton swipes that you can buy from Guardian. Wet them in sterile liquid. I use those saline solution that get from the pharmacy in big bottles.. I think it's for contact lenses but it has to be natural saline solution. Shih tzu eyes also sensitive to dryness so buy a gel that you can get from vets or you can use Liquifilm tears. Do not use Eyemo, my vet adviced me not too... can't remember why... but it may irritate the eyes of a dog.

Red ants can bite, so better you get rid of the red ants. You can try this. Use a cloth that is wet with white vinegar and wipe the areas that red ants will come. Ants and some insects don't like vinegar smell.

Yup, simple saline will do. Use the cotton pad to wipe the eye gently. Wet the cotton bad until it is soft and watery then wipe the eye. Don't use tissue paper coz it is rougher than cotton. You will have to hold the eye lid apart coz your puppy will try and close its eyes. The mucus on the eye ball, means I think your puppy got dry eyes. Get the eye drop I recommanded or get those eye gels from vet to put so the eyes will not get the dry irritation and it will have less mucus.

Ohhh... better not bath so often. Will make her skin dry and she will have more dandruff and may have skin irritations coz the lack of natural oils on her skin and fur.

What shampoo you use? My shih tzu use Fido shampoo last time, the perfume can last quite long. Sometimes the odour/smell can come from the ears. My shih tzu last time will only become smelly if I never bath him for more than 1 week. He lives indoors but always go outdoors.

Your Rainbow smells like pee ah? Well, another way to handle this situation is trim the fur around her legs. If you think it's the feet that smells ah, just wash the feet with soapy water, no need the whole body.

If your Rainbow smells after a few days, I suggest you buy the powder dry shampoo. It's like shampoo but not soapy and in powder form. Smells nice.
